Is Buttercup or Infisical better?

Neither is universally better. Infisical has the larger community, while Buttercup is simpler to set up (easy difficulty). Choose based on the comparison table above and your own setup.

Are Buttercup and Infisical free and open-source?

Yes. Buttercup is licensed under GPL-3.0 and Infisical under MIT. Both can be self-hosted at no software cost.
